6. Deatrich Wise, DE

The Patriots switched their defensive scheme from a 4-3 in 2018 to a 3-4 in 2019. It didn’t really suit Wise. He’s a lanky defensive end, whose frame works in a 4-3 defense, which he gets help from four defensive down-linemen, including two defensive tackles. But in a 3-4 defense, Wise got additional attention from offensive linemen, and wasn’t big enough to hold down his spot on the line. As a result, he played just 22% of defensive snaps. Perhaps with an offseason to put on weight and learn that new position, Wise might find himself more comfortable on the edge.
